Introduction of Actual Madrid’s Financial Condition.

For the 2024/25 season, Genuine Madrid preserves its position as the most affluent football club globally, with Forbes valuing it at over EUR5 billion. Your understanding of their economic wellness starts with their EUR843 million annual revenue, driven by sponsorships, broadcasting, and matchday incomes. Regardless of high wage costs– EUR280 million for player salaries– their sensible economic management makes certain earnings, unlike opponents strained by debt. Secret to this security is their minimal dependence on gamer sales, concentrating rather on commercial growth and arena profits from the remodelled Bernabéu.

Highest-Paid Athletes.

An elite triad controls Actual Madrid’s payroll: Kylian Mbappé (₤ 600,692/ week), David Alaba (₤ 432,692/ week), and Luka Modrić (₤ 420,769/ week). Mbappé’s complimentary transfer from PSG featured a record-breaking wage, making him the highest-paid player in the squad. Alaba and Modrić, though in their 30s, justify their wages with management and consistency. You’ll observe the club’s method: incentive tried and tested victors while purchasing generational talents like Vinícius and Bellingham.

Thorough Weekly Wages.

At the Bernabéu, salaries mirror both efficiency and capacity. Vinícius Júnior and Jude Bellingham make ₤ 400,577 once a week, while Thibaut Courtois (₤ 288,525) supports the defense. Midfielders like Aurélien Tchouaméni and Eduardo Camavinga (₤ 240,385) highlight the young people motion, while veterans like Dani Carvajal (₤ 200,385) give security. The team’s depth is obvious, with also rotational players like Lucas Vázquez (₤ 180,385) earning top-tier incomes.

One more layer to the wage structure discloses calculated top priorities. Mbappé’s income overshadows others, but rising stars like Rodrygo (₤ 240,385) and Éder Militão (₤ 280,385) are locked right into long-lasting deals. The separation of Toni Kroos liberated ₤ 468,846/ week, reinvested in more youthful possessions. You’ll see how Real Madrid balances short-term celebrity power with lasting preparation, guaranteeing the squad stays competitive throughout all competitions.

Gamer Transfers and Their Influence on Incomes.

It reshapes your wage framework when top-level arrivals and separations take place. Genuine Madrid’s 2024/25 squad sees Kylian Mbappé’s cost-free transfer as the standout action, quickly making him the top income earner at ₤ 600,692 regular. Meanwhile, departures like Toni Kroos’ retirement and Nacho Fernández’s cost-free transfer to Al-Qadsiah maximize substantial wages, balancing the books regardless of Mbappé’s monstrous salary.

New Signings for 2024/25.

On the inbound front, Mbappé’s arrival dominates, but Endrick’s EUR46.5 M signing includes a long-lasting possession with a small wage. Joselu’s return from Espanyol (EUR1.5 M) and funding returnees like Reinier provide depth without straining payroll, making certain economic flexibility for future relocations.

Separations and Their Economic Results.

Their leaves produce prompt alleviation: Kroos’ retirement saves ₤ 468,846 weekly, while Nacho’s separation cuts one more ₤ 180,385. Rafa Marín’s EUR11.7 M sale to Napoli offsets costs, however losing experienced leadership dangers team communication. Joselu’s funding expiry and Kepa’s return to Chelsea further trim costs.

Salaries freed from departures total over ₤ 1M weekly, alleviating FFP pressure. Nonetheless, changing Kroos’ creativity and Nacho’s adaptability will not be cheap. The club’s technique leans on youth, yet spaces in experience might prove pricey in tight matches.
